标题:扑捉鼠标的位置
只看楼主
kingarden
Rank: 2
等 级:论坛游民
威 望:1
帖 子:517
专家分:40
注 册:2004-12-8
 问题点数:0 回复次数:2 
扑捉鼠标的位置
/* 在本程序中目的是为了扑捉鼠标的位置
   鼠标在哪儿点一下,“I am here“在那个
   位置出现。*/

import java.applet.*;
import java.awt.*;

public class Class8 extends Applet
{
    int pointx,pointy;
    public void init()
    {pointx=-1;
     pointy=-1;
     resize(300,400);  //显示区大小。
    }
    public void paint(Graphics g)
    {
      if(pointx!=-1)
          g.drawString("I am here",pointx,pointy);
         
    }
        public boolean mouseDown(Event evt,int x,int y)
        {
        pointx=x;
            pointy=y;  //在这里捕捉到鼠标的x和y的坐标。
            repaint();
            return true;
        }
}
搜索更多相关主题的帖子: 鼠标 位置 
2005-01-10 16:34
yms123
Rank: 16Rank: 16Rank: 16Rank: 16
等 级:版主
威 望:209
帖 子:12488
专家分:19042
注 册:2004-7-17
得分:0 
鼠标移动事件的时间对象就应该有getx和gety两个方法来取得当前鼠标的坐标值。
2005-01-11 00:07
逝去身影
Rank: 1
等 级:新手上路
帖 子:25
专家分:0
注 册:2005-4-29
得分:0 
好的 我研究一下 不会再问 多谢了

2005-04-29 14:23



参与讨论请移步原网站贴子:https://bbs.bccn.net/thread-11064-1-1.html




关于我们 | 广告合作 | 编程中国 | 清除Cookies | TOP | 手机版

编程中国 版权所有,并保留所有权利。
Powered by Discuz, Processed in 0.846163 second(s), 9 queries.
Copyright©2004-2025, BCCN.NET, All Rights Reserved